Quoting Sam Varshavchik <mr...@courier-mta.com>:That's fine. courier-authlib is a separate module. It does not know anything about what's in the imapd configuration file. MAILDIRPATH is processed by the imapd daemon after a succesful login.Well, it seems to be working now....But I must confess I am confused. The authtest still says "maildir: (none)". I understand you say it doesn't read /etc/courier/imapd -- but then where does it get this info from?
It doesn't. It does its job, the userid/password is authenticated, and imapd is started. Since imapd does not receive maildir's location from authdaemond, it uses the default value from the imapd configuration file.
